Why Are Wholesale Bathroom Faucets So Popular?

When it comes to cost-effectiveness, Wholesale Bathroom Faucets can be bought in bulk at 40-60% below retail price. Innovation with technology reduces long-term costs. The PVD coating process (Mohs hardness ≥6H) extends faucet life from 5 years to 10 years and reduces the chance of surface oxidation from 35% to 3%. The return rate of the nano coating technology (thickness 30μm) from a Foshan factory was only 0.8%, and after-sales cost savings were $15/piece versus conventional electroplating (return rate 3.5%). Smart thermostatic spool (500,000 switching lifetime) failure rate of only 0.2% (standard rubber spool 4%), such as Kohler (Kohler) Touchless series in Dubai luxury projects to reduce maintenance frequency to 0.1 compared to 1.5 times annually.
